Small credit unions will have the opportunity to win one of two full scholarships to the 2018 CUNA Governmental Affairs Conference (GAC) in Washington, D.C., through a contest that starts Monday from CUNA and sponsored by CUNA Mutual Group.

The contest is open to CUNA members below $100 million in assets, and participants can earn entries into the drawings for the scholarships–which include airfare, lodging up to four nights, registration and incidentals–by participating in the CUNA Small Credit Union Community, an online networking and small credit union resource platform.

To receive an entry into the drawings, a user must:

  • Sign up for a “Daily Digest” or “Real Time” email subscription to the Small Credit Union Community; and
  • Post at least one question or response in the Discussion. Additional posts will earn additional entries.

The contest starts Monday and will run through Jan. 19, 2018. Winners will be drawn and announced on the Community on Jan. 29, 2018.

“The contest helps us strengthen our connection to small credit unions,” said Tom Sakash, CUNA small credit union advisor. “First, it generates engagement with the Community–a free member resource that easily allows small credit unions to network and share information and strategies without ever leaving their offices. And second, it brings more small credit union voices to GAC.”

Winners will also be recognized at the CUNA Small Credit Union Roundtable at GAC, set for 1 to 3:30 p.m. (ET) on Sunday, Feb. 25.

The roundtable is also sponsored by CUNA Mutual Group.

“Small credit unions are an important part of the American financial landscape and the credit union movement,” said Rob Purtell, vice president of sales for CUNA Mutual Group. “We value small credit unions, and we’re proud to sponsor this GAC contest.”

The League of Southeastern Credit Unions & Affiliates represents 302 credit unions in Alabama, Florida and Georgia, with a combined total of $175 billion in assets and more than 11.6 million members. LSCU & Affiliates provides legislative and regulatory advocacy; education and training; cooperative initiatives (including financial education outreach); public messaging; information services; and business solutions.
